A presente dissertação versa sobre a importância da Avaliação Multidimensional
no Regime Jurídico do Maior Acompanhado, introduzido pela Lei n.º 49/2018 de 14 de
agosto, que revogou o regime da Interdição e Inabilitação. A compreensão das
necessidades de cada indivíduo em concreto torna-se basilar para combater as medidas
ditas “amplas” do antigo regime. A promoção da capacidade que o indivíduo ainda detém,
embora de certo modo condicionada, é a matriz do novo Regime Jurídico. O
envelhecimento como forma de limitação da capacidade não implica necessariamente
uma medida restritiva ou limitadora da liberdade da pessoa. Assim, impera na aplicação
da medida de acompanhamento um conhecimento mais profundo através do instrumento
da Avaliação Multidimensional que procura conhecer as várias dimensões em análise do
indivíduo, designadamente quanto ao seu capital social, cultural, económico e simbólico.
Este estudo tem por objetivo compreender a pertinência da Avaliação
Multidimensional para a elaboração dos relatórios periciais, quando solicitados no âmbito
deste Regime.
Deste modo, a metodologia desenvolvida foi o estudo de caso, com caráter
qualitativo, pela realização de entrevistas a um grupo de 16 profissionais, como atores
judiciários nacionais, interventores sociais, organizações da sociedade civil e
interventores na área da saúde, pertencentes ao Distrito Judicial do Porto. De forma, a
tratar os dados recorreu-se à análise de conteúdo e análise documental.
Os resultados obtidos nesta dissertação mostraram-se significativamente positivos
quanto à implementação de equipas multidisciplinares, com técnicos especializados,
fornecendo o conhecimento técnico necessário e exigido para os vários intervenientes no
âmbito deste processo, nomeadamente os decisores.
This dissertation addresses the importance of Multidimensional Assessment in the Legal System for the Adult Accompanied, introduced by Law No. 49/2018 of 14 August, which revoked the Interdiction and Disability regime. Understanding the needs of each individual in particular becomes essential to fight the so-called “broad” measures of the old regime. Supporting the capacity that the individual still has, although in a conditioned way, is the foundation of the new Legal Regime. Aging, as a way of limiting capacity does not necessarily imply a restrictive or limiting measure of a person's freedom. Therefore, in the application of the accompanying measure, a deeper knowledge prevails through the Multidimensional Assessment tool that seeks to know the various dimensions under analysis of the individual, namely regarding their social, cultural, economic and symbolic capital. This study aims to understand the relevance of Multidimensional Assessment for the preparation of expert reports, when requested under this Regime. Thus, the methodology developed was a case study, with a qualitative character, by conducting interviews with a group of 16 professionals, such as national judicial actors, social actors, civil society organizations and actors in the health area, belonging to the Judicial District from Porto. In order to treat the data, content analysis and document analysis were used. The results obtained in this dissertation were shown to be significantly positive regarding the implementation of multidisciplinary teams, with specialized technicians, providing the necessary and required technical knowledge to the various actors involved in this process, namely decision makers.
